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Nestled in the heart of Kaysville, Utah, Bishop's Field benefits from a central location along the Wasatch Front. The primary access route is Main Street, which runs north-south through the city and connects directly to Interstate 15. This makes getting to the venue straightforward, with clear signage for sports complexes. Salt Lake City International Airport (SLC) is approximately a 30-40 minute drive to the southwest, depending on traffic conditions. For those arriving by car, numerous parking lots are available directly at the facility, though they can fill up quickly during peak event times. Public transportation options are limited in Kaysville, so most visitors rely on personal vehicles or rideshares. Smart arrival tactics suggest aiming to reach the venue at least 30-45 minutes before your scheduled game or activity to account for parking and navigation within the complex.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Kaysville is cold, with average daily temperatures ranging from the low 20s to the low 40s Fahrenheit. Snow is common, which may affect field accessibility or lead to event cancellations or rescheduling. Visitors should pack warm layers, including heavy coats, hats, and gloves, and be prepared for slick conditions when traveling.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ring and early summer offer a transition to more temperate weather, with average temperatures climbing from the 50s to the 70s Fahrenheit. These months are ideal for outdoor activities, though occasional rain showers can occur. Lightweight layers, a light jacket, and comfortable walking shoes are recommended, along with sunscreen for sunny days.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er, from July through August, is characterized by warm to hot temperatures, often reaching into the 80s and 90s Fahrenheit. Days are long and sunny, making hydration and sun protection paramount for anyone spending time at the fields. Light, breathable clothing is essential, along with hats and sunglasses.

🍂

Fall season

Fall brings cooler temperatures and beautiful foliage, with average highs in the 60s and 70s Fahrenheit, dropping into the 40s and 50s at night. This season is excellent for outdoor sports, though cooler evenings may require a jacket or sweater. Days are generally comfortable, ideal for extended periods outside.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is most common in the spring and fall, while snow is typical in the winter. Both can impact game schedules, potentially causing delays or cancellations. Always check weather forecasts before heading to the venue and be prepared with rain gear or warm, waterproof clothing as needed. Indoor backup plans are advisable during inclement weather seasons.
